主页 > tp钱包和imtoken钱包通用吗 > 【区块链笔记整理】玩家一号——寻找中本聪的100万比特币

【区块链笔记整理】玩家一号——寻找中本聪的100万比特币

tp钱包和imtoken钱包通用吗 2023-03-12 07:34:18

前言:

据传,中本聪在早期挖矿中一共获得了110万个BTC。 这个说法最初来自一个叫Sergio的博主,他有一篇文章对此进行了详细的解释。 如果您有兴趣,可以查看比特币创造者、远见者和天才中本聪的当之无愧的财富。 是否属实,限于篇幅这里不展开讨论。 另外,我们知道只要有比特币私钥中本聪110万比特币地址,就可以拿到地址的比特币。 我们能找到这些比特币吗? 或许中本聪就像《玩家一号》中的绿洲首富一样,将自己的财富永远留给后人去发掘。

可能性

我一直说比特币私钥是无法破解的。 科学性如何? 虽然一直都在说加密算法有多严谨,但从来没有过更直观的感受,所以做了如下计算和对比:

比特币私钥由256位0或1组成,生成的地址为160位,则:

2^256≈ 1.158 * 10^77 //私钥总数

2^160≈ 1.462 * 10^48 //地址总数

例如破解当前持有比特币最多的地址(185,884):3D2oetdNuZUqQHPJmcMDDHYoqkyNVsFk9r

中本聪110万比特币地址_中本聪比特币论文 pdf_比特币与中本聪

由于不能从地址反推私钥,只能靠暴力破解。 那么,用私钥只得到一次地址的概率为:

(因为一个私钥总能得到一个地址,一个地址平均有2^96个私钥)

1/2^160=6.842 * 10^-49 // 穷举得到正解的概率

你可能会说带比特币的地址有很多,可能遇到其他带比特币的地址你也不一定能打到最多的地址。 我们看一下btc.com的统计表,计算如下:

BTC余额、地址数量、概率

>0.001, 13500000, 9.23707*10^-42

中本聪110万比特币地址_比特币与中本聪_中本聪比特币论文 pdf

>0.01, 6000000, 4.10537*10^-42

>0.1, 2300000, 1.57372*10^-42

>1, 610000, 4.17379*10^-43 // 余额大于1btc的地址大约有610000个,一次性获得的概率

上面好像没有多少直观感受,我们算一下双色球的概率(33选6加16选1)

1/((33*32*31*30*29*28)/(6*5*4*3*2*1)*16)=5.643*10^-8 //中一等奖的概率复彩双色球

也就是说,我们单次耗尽得到0.001个以上比特币的概率比双色球中的数字差了34个数量级,不是倍数,而是一个数量级

中本聪110万比特币地址_中本聪比特币论文 pdf_比特币与中本聪

9.23707*10^-42/5.643*10^-8=1.63691*10^-34 // 福利彩票的34个数量级。 . .

可能不够直观,我们再看一个例子:地球的质量约为6*10^24kg,假设一粒沙子重约1*10^-6kg(1毫克),

假设地球上所有的沙子都是这样均匀的,那么在地球上找到这个沙子的概率就是:

1*10^-6/6*10^24≈ 1.67 *10^-31

感受一下:找一粒沙子,在地球的任何一个角落(里里外外),破解比特币的概率都比这小十几个数量级。

时间

中本聪110万比特币地址_中本聪比特币论文 pdf_比特币与中本聪

有人认为这是一次,电脑能很快完成并一直运行下去,说不定就会被发现了。

假设我们一秒可以跑9.5*10^11次,根据这个值计算概率。

(这个预估数据来自Motherboard的报告。Large Bitcoin Collider暴力破解组织用了大约一年的时间遍历了3000万亿(3*10^16)个私钥。原文链接:The Large Bitcoin Collider Is Generating Trillions of Keys and Breaking Into Wallets 和该组织发布了发现余额的地址的私钥:Pool Trophies。)

365*24*60*60*9.5*10^11≈ 3 *10^19 //每年运算次数

3 *10^19*1.57372*10^-42≈4.7* 10^-23 // 一年内找到1个余额>0.1BTC的概率

1/4.7* 10^-23≈2*10^22 年 // 找到余额所需的时间 > 0.1BTC

比特币与中本聪_中本聪比特币论文 pdf_中本聪110万比特币地址

找到余额为180,000 btc的地址私钥的时间计算如下:4.88*10^29年

这样一个数量级,就算有10亿个这样的组织,我们也不是几辈子就能完成的。

结论:

上面说的概率和穷举时间都是天文数字。 或许未来的某一天,高科技可以被破解,届时比特币也会与时俱进,所以比特币的安全性确实是有科学依据的。

但 -

确实,目前已经有部分私钥被“破解”,包括上面提到的LBC组织,也“破解”了几个。 我认为有些人在设置和生成私钥时并没有那么谨慎。 还有所谓的“大脑钱包”,通过解码一些常见的短语就可以轻松破解中本聪110万比特币地址,比如有的是用“hello world”生成的: hashlib.sha256(bytes('Hello World', 'utf-8') ). digest(),十六进制:a591a6d40bf420404a011733cfb7b190d62c65bf0bcda32b57b277d9ad9f146e,对应地址:1LGWpj3pqbzYWvTLEcBKP6CS5PQkxBgjXj。 这里已经进行了几笔交易。

所以也许,就像玩家一号一样,有人真的很幸运,在没有任何线索的情况下遇到了一个? 前额。 . . . 或许。

比特币与中本聪_中本聪比特币论文 pdf_中本聪110万比特币地址

目前观测到的宇宙质量是10^80kg,所以说私钥就是宇宙的大小